Tutorial
1. After you have installed i-Funbox, you need to plug in your iDevice in your computer and start up i-Funboxxx. :rolleyes:
Now go over to 'System Applications'
You must login or register to view this content.
2. As you can see, you can edit your apps from here.
If you double click on one, you see whats all inside..
Lets leave that for now, and get some icons Winky Winky
Just save my or someone else's icons to your computer..
If you want to make your own, make sure to make it 60 x 60 pixels, and save it as a .PNG File!
My custom Icons;
You must login or register to view this content.You must login or register to view this content.You must login or register to view this content.
So now when you have icons, lets open up an app and change its icon.
Important: If you are using a theme, head over to the themes map, find your theme and click on the icon you want to replace!
Im going to change my Clock's icon, pick your app and double click on it, like so
You must login or register to view this content.
3. Now we're going to drag our custom icon into the app, once its in there rename the icon to 'icon.png'
You must login or register to view this content.
4.Now just respring/restart your iPhone and voilá! Enjoy your custom icon.
